Have you ever wondered
what the odds are that you might be a crime victim, or become one
again? The statistics are startling. Of course, a lot depends on who
you are, where you live, where you work, your daily routine - and how
lucky you are. Lifestyle has a lot to do with it but anyone, anywhere,
at any time can be innocently swept up and involved in a crime.
*Consider these
odds:
-
1
of every 39 Americans will be the victim of a violent crime - THIS YEAR
-
1
of every 6 women will be raped in their life time (80% are unreported)
-
50%
of all juveniles will fall victim to a violent crime between ages 12-17
-
28%
of students age 12-18 will be bullied at school, 24% of those bullied
will sustain an injury
-
35%
of adults will be a victim of a violent crime sometime in their life
-
there
is a 100% chance that you will experience a theft in your life time
-
and
an 87% chance that you will experience theft 3+ times
-
3
of every 4 households are burglarized every 20 years
-
1
of 4 households have a car stolen every 20 years
Sobering isn't it?
Law enforcement touts
that crime
rates have come down from their peak in the 1980's...and that's true.
The crime rate has fallen 1-2%. But what they don't tell you is that
the NUMBER of crimes continues to rise proportionately to our
population growth. The US population in 1980 was 227 million. Today our
population is 307 million, which represents a 40% increase in
population AND the NUMBER of crimes since 1980. Simply put, more people
- more crime.
